Utah Ending a Lease Through Failure of Condition refers to the legal process by which a tenant can terminate their lease agreement due to the landlord's failure to maintain the property in a habitable condition. This ensures that tenants have the right to live in a safe and well-maintained environment. When a landlord fails to provide proper maintenance or address serious issues that affect the habitability of the rental property, tenants may resort to ending their lease through failure of condition. In such cases, tenants have legal rights and protections under Utah state law. One type of failure of condition involves the presence of serious health and safety hazards, such as mold, lead-based paint, or structural faults. In these cases, tenants can typically demonstrate that the condition poses a significant risk to their well-being and, if left unaddressed, would violate their right to a habitable living space. Another type of failure of condition occurs when essential utilities or services become non-functional or significantly impaired. This includes the failure of water or electricity supply, inadequate heating or cooling systems, faulty plumbing, or lack of necessary repairs to the property. If the landlord fails to address these issues, tenants may have grounds to terminate their lease agreement. To initiate the process of ending a lease through failure of condition in Utah, tenants must typically follow specific steps outlined by the state law. It is crucial to first provide written notice to the landlord, clearly detailing the specific conditions or issues that violate the warranty of habitability. This notice should also request appropriate repairs or steps towards resolving the problems within a reasonable timeframe. If the landlord fails to respond or adequately address the issues within a reasonable timeframe, tenants may need to consult an attorney or seek further guidance from the local housing authority. In some cases, tenants may be allowed to withhold rent until the conditions are rectified or pursue legal remedies like claiming damages or terminating the lease agreement. The property you are renting must be habitable and when your landlord rents you the property your landlord warrants to you that it is habitable. Basic living requirements, such as heat, hot water, working sewer, etc., must be provided and maintained.

If the problems are dangerous, you can give the landlord notice by any means possible, including by telephone. The landlord has 24 hours to start making the repairs after you give them notice. If your landlord refuses to fix major problems in your housing, you can break your lease and move.
